
Watch Lionel Messi Score Historic 900th Career Goal in Inter Miami's Game vs. Nashville SC
Inter Miami star Lionel Messi hit another major milestone in his legendary career.
With a goal in the seventh minute against Nashville SC, he now has 900 total for club and country.

Here's how that breaks down by team:
- Barcelona: 672
- Paris Saint-Germain: 32
- Inter Miami: 81
- Argentina: 115
Most would probably consider Messi as superior on the pitch to Cristiano Ronaldo, his longtime competitive rival. He has eight Ballon d'Or wins to five for Ronaldo, more wins in head-to-head matches, and his World Cup triumph with Argentina in 2022 trumps Cristiano lifting a Euro 2016 trophy with Portugal.
Cristiano does have a decisive edge in goals, though. His career tally is up to 965 and counting, and he could be the first men's player ever to reach 1,000. Brazilian club Santos claims Pele had 1,091 goals, but that number isn't officially recognized.
That's one benchmark Messi may not reach.
The 38-year-old has been prolific in MLS. He scored 29 goals in 26 appearances last season and already has four to open the 2026 campaign counting Wednesday's goal in the Concacaf Champions Cup.
The two-time MVP is signed through 2028 as well, so he isn't planning to retire soon.
Still, Messi's age has to catch up to him at some point. If the past is an indicator, he could also hit a bit of a post-World Cup lull, assuming he takes part. His form at PSG tailed off once he returned from the 2022 tournament.
Argentina coach Lionel Scaloni hasn't finalized his squad yet, but it's hard to imagine Messi being omitted as long as he's healthy. Balancing the World Cup and Inter Miami's MLS Cup defense will require a heavy burden.
Inter boss Javier Mascherano has already cited the need to manage Messi's workload, and that's going to be even more acute midway through the summer.
In terms of chasing down Ronaldo, sitting out matches for Inter Miami will cost Messi valuable time.
